A can of carb cleaner has a little red plastic tube that controls the
spray pattern of the cleaner. No "clouds" are formed. Its one of those
"things to try in a pinch" kinda of tools.
Now if you have the "proper tool", then by all means use it. But I have
never met your average "Joe Schmoe" with a propane tank vacuum leak
detector.
I know of many dealers that dont have one either!
So "in a pinch" an aerosol, via a plastic tube to reduce atomization, on
a "cold" engine, with an idea of where the leak is, works well, and is
used extensively! One day... I may... buy myself the "proper" tool.
